Vibration Detection Device - What Are Acceptable Vibration Levels?

What are perceptible vibration levels for humans? Following ISO 2631-1, the vibration PEAK acceleration of 0.015 m/s2 is an acceptable vibration level for building occupants. If the floor vibrations are only slightly above this level then building occupants are likely to complain.

What equipment is used for vibration analysis?

Vibration Analysis Sensors The most common sensor used in vibration analysis is the accelerometer, however you may also find velocity transducers and displacement probes. In fact, accelerometers provide a voltage output whose amplitude is proportional to the acceleration of the vibration.

Where are vibration sensors used?

Vibration sensors designed for monitoring applications are used to monitor motors, critical pumps, fans, gearboxes, and compressors in the oil and gas industry.

What is vibration detection device?

A vibration sensor is a device that measures the amount and frequency of vibration in a given system, machine, or piece of equipment. Those measurements can be used to detect imbalances or other issues in the asset and predict future breakdowns.

Which tools are considered high risk for vibration?

Common Sources of Vibration Grinders, chipping hammers, sanders, pavement breakers, impact drills, air-powered wrenches, saws of all types, and even dental tools can all be sources of vibration that, if used repeatedly for long periods of time, could cause hand-arm vibration injury.

What is sensitivity of vibration sensor?

In a standard application (50g range), the sensitivity of a typical vibration sensor is 100mV/g, while in low vibration applications (10g) the sensitivity is 500mV/G. Vibration frequency – Knowing the frequency span you need to measure is as important as knowing the vibration range.

What is the output of vibration sensor?

Vibration sensors (4-20mA) They provide a 4-20 mA output signal proportional to the overall vibration level. The 4-20 mA output is commonly accepted by process control systems such as a PLC, DCS or SCADA system for cost-effective continuous vibration monitoring.

What is the human vibration frequency?

Human Vibration Parameter Comparison and Result Discussion. According to the existing research, the natural frequency of a human-standing body is about 7.5 Hz, and the frequency of a sitting posture in the cab is generally 4–6 Hz.

How do I choose a vibration sensor?

As a rule of thumb, if the machine produces high amplitude vibrations (greater than 10 g rms) at the measurement point, a low sensitivity (10 mV/g) sensor is preferable. If the vibration is less than 10 g rms, a 100 mV/g sensor should generally be used.

What are the different types of vibration sensors?

The general types of vibration sensors include displacement sensors, velocity sensors, and accelerometers. Accelerometers are the best choice for most industrial rotating assets because they are simple, easy to apply, and very sensitive to the high-frequency vibrations typically generated during force-failure.

What are the disadvantage of vibration?

Vibration can cause changes in tendons, muscles, bones and joints, and can affect the nervous system. Collectively, these effects are known as Hand-Arm Vibration Syndrome (HAVS). Workers affected by HAVS commonly report: attacks of whitening (blanching) of one or more fingers when exposed to cold.
